
Capital: Topeka
Largest City: Wichita
Abbreviation: KS
Joined the Union: January 29, 1861
Nickname: The Sunflower State
In the heart of the nation, Kansas is rich with rolling hills and prairies stretching as far as the eye can see. Cemented in the national fabric by industries like agriculture, aviation and cattle farming, the state is known for its numerous bison herds, stellar basketball and background role in The Wizard of Oz.
